The Meat House first opened in Portsmouth, NH, in 2003, and has since grown to include locations in six states, including Maine, Massachusetts, New Hampshire, and New York in the local region. The shops focus on premium cuts of meat and personalized service, and products offered include all kinds of meat (including exotic meats), cheese, wine, marinades, produce, baked goods, prepared meals, and more.
[April 26 update: The Meat House is now open in Arlington.]
The address for this upcoming butcher shop in Arlington will be: The Meat House, 1398 Massachusetts Avenue, Arlington, MA, 02476. The website for the company is: http://www.themeathouse.com/

